CA condemns mob attack on bookstall, orders investigation

Chief Adviser Professor Muhammad Yunus has strongly condemned the mob attack on a bookstall at the Ekushey Book Fair, calling it an act of contempt for the rights of Bangladeshi citizens and the laws of the country.

"The attack shows contempt for both the rights of Bangladeshi citizens and for the laws of our country," the Chief Adviser's Press Wing said in a statement on Monday.

Such violence betrays the open-minded spirit of this great Bangladeshi cultural fixture, which commemorates the language martyrs who lost their lives on 21 February 1952 in defence of their mother tongue, the statement read.

The Ekushey Book Fair, a key cultural event, serves as a daily gathering place for writers and readers.

In response to the incident, the Interim Government has ordered police and the Bangla Academy to investigate and hold the perpetrators accountable.

Authorities have also heightened security at the fair and pledged to prevent future mob violence in the country.
